The Maintenance and Energy Management department is comprised of three areas - campus maintenance, energy management, and utilities and automation.

Zone Maintenance

The six maintenance zones incorporate the four skilled trades – carpentry, electrical, heating and air conditioning, and plumbing - into geographic areas of responsibility based on building locations, size, and maintenance requirements.

Energy Management

The Energy Management team work with Maintenance and Operations, Planning, Design and Construction, and to design, develop, implement, and track energy efficiency initiatives and campus and powerhouse improvement projects as well as develop the Campus Utility Master Plan. Projects range from design of new chilled water distribution to energy saving projects such as lighting retrofits, lighting controls and steam turbine chiller installations.

“Promote energy awareness, accountability and conservation to the ԭ community, our institutional peers and the greater Nashville area; and provide the tools to share energy information, promote an understanding of our consumption, and empower people to affect change.”

The Energy Efficiency and Metering group has a goal of total energy accountability, meaning all utilities are tracked and understood by the ԭ community.

As a large energy consumer, ԭ has a unique opportunity to lower our environmental impact (while saving money) through resource conservation actions such as energy conservation. The university currently meters many utilities at the building level and is working towards completing building-level metering on all buildings on campus, and by tracking and understanding these metrics allows the university to make well-informed decisions on how systems are operating and how they can be improved.


Building Automation

Building Automation is maintained by the Building Control Group whose roles and responsibilities are:

  • Maintain JCI and ALC building automation systems across campus​​
  • Write, program, and implement control strategies for different systems across campus​
  • Aid maintenance zones in troubleshooting and service calls​
  • Perform controls projects for Planning, Design and Construction on an as needed basis
  • Analyze fault detectionin order toimprove energy performance andequipment reliability

Fire & Life Safety

The Fire & Life Safety team roles and responsibilities:

  • Troubleshoot and maintain fire alarm, sprinkler, camera, panic buttons, and lighting controls systems.
  • Conduct all quarterly, semi-annual, and annual life safety system testing.
  • Coordinate and direct contractor and project work that affects fire alarm or sprinkler systems.
  • Install security systems and panic buttons by request.

Building Systems Controls (BSC)

Building Systems Control (BSC) is ԭ's Maintenance and Operation's main control center for monitoring fire alarms, security alarms, and building control systems. The control systems supervisors dispatch personnel and/or contractors to make repairs and modifications. BSC receives on average 80 phone calls a day and generates an average of 400 work orders per month. BSC oversees:

  • Control bollard access to Greek Row​
  • Monitor and operate fire alarm systems, security systems and building automation HVAC systems​
  • Internal ԭ central point of contact by phone​
  • Work order generation​
  • After hours dispatch and control​
  • Key checkout and control​
  • Outage notification and coordination​
  • Coordination with VUPD for campusemergencies

Distributed Water

Chilled Water Group roles and responsibilities:

  • Maintain chilled water to all of campus​
  • Perform annual preventative maintenance on chillers and cooling towers each winter​
  • Chemical treatment performed by NashvilleChemical
